Atlassian shares slide as restructuring fallout and AI-disruption jitters linger

None

Atlassian Corporation (TEAM) is down 7.2% today. Here is some analysis on what might have caused this price movement.

Analysis: The most likely driver appears to be continued investor unease around Atlassian’s March restructuring and what it signals about near-term growth and margins in an “AI-first” transition. With the stock already volatile in recent weeks, today’s drop could also reflect risk-off positioning in software names as traders reassess how AI agents might pressure seat-based SaaS models.

Details:

  • Atlassian disclosed a restructuring plan to reduce headcount by about 10% (roughly 1,600 employees) to “self-fund” increased investment in AI and enterprise sales while aiming to improve efficiency.
  • The company flagged expected restructuring-related charges of roughly $225 million to $236 million, largely tied to severance and office-space reductions, with completion expected by the end of fiscal 2026.
  • The same restructuring disclosure reaffirmed Atlassian’s previously issued guidance for Q3 and the full fiscal year 2026, suggesting the move is more about cost structure and strategic reprioritization than an immediate guidance reset.
  • Separate company communications have emphasized deeper AI product integration (including Rovo and broader platform initiatives), but investors have debated whether AI will be a net tailwind or a source of competitive disruption for collaboration and workflow tools.
